Commercial fire restoration services involve a comprehensive process to repair and recover properties affected by fire damage. When a fire occurs in a commercial building, it can cause extensive harm not only from flames but also from smoke, soot, and water used to extinguish the fire. Service providers focus on removing debris, cleaning surfaces, and restoring the building’s structural integrity. This process often includes odor removal and specialized cleaning to ensure the property is safe and ready for occupancy or further renovation.
These services help resolve a variety of problems that arise after a fire incident. Smoke and soot can settle on walls, ceilings, and equipment, leading to persistent odors and potential corrosion. Water damage from firefighting efforts can weaken building materials and promote mold growth if not addressed promptly. Additionally, structural damage may compromise the safety of the premises. Professional fire restoration aims to mitigate these issues efficiently, helping property owners minimize downtime and prevent further deterioration.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Fire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Arlington,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small Fire Damage Repairs - These typically range from $250 to $600 for many smaller jobs, such as cleaning soot or minor surface repairs. Many routine projects fall within this middle range, handling common damage scenarios efficiently.
Moderate Restoration Projects - Projects involving extensive cleaning, smoke odor removal, and partial structural repairs us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ex jobs can reach $4,000 or more, but most projects stay within this band.
Major Fire Damage Restoration - Large-scale restorations, including full structural repairs and extensive cleanup, can range from $5,000 to $15,000. These are less common but are typical for serious incidents requiring comprehensive services.
Full Fire Replacement - Complete building rebuilds or major reconstruction efforts can exceed $20,000, depending on size and scope. Most service providers handle projects that fall below this level, with higher costs reserved for extensive, complex restorations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is commercial fire restoration? Commercial fire restoration involves cleaning, repairing, and restoring business properties affected by fire damage to return them to their pre-loss condition.
Which types of fire damage do restoration services cover? Restoration services typically address smoke and soot damage, water damage from firefighting efforts, structural damage, and damaged HVAC systems in commercial buildings.
How do local contractors handle fire damage assessments? Fire damage assessments involve inspecting the property to determine the extent of damage and identifying necessary repairs, with experienced service providers providing detailed evaluations.
Are contents and inventory restored during commercial fire restoration? Many service providers offer content cleaning and restoration for business inventory, documents, and equipment affected by fire and smoke damage.
What steps are involved in the commercial fire restoration process? The process generally includes damage assessment, debris removal, cleaning, repairs, and restoration to ensure the property is safe and functional again.
